3564b828684SBarry Smith /*@C
357052efed2SBarry Smith    MatCreateShell - Creates a new matrix class for use with a user-defined
358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    private data storage format.
359e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
360c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ith   Collective on MPI_Comm
361c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ith 
362e51e0e81SBarry Smith    Input Parameters:
363c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ith +  comm - MPI communicator
364c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ith .  m - number of local rows (must be given)
365c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ith .  n - number of local columns (must be given)
366c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ith .  M - number of global rows (may be PETSC_DETERMINE)
367c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ith .  N - number of global columns (may be PETSC_DETERMINE)
368c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ith -  ctx - pointer to data needed by the shell matrix routines
369e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
370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    Output Parameter:
37144cd7ae7SLois Curfman McInnes .  A - the matrix
372e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
373ff2fd236SBarry Smith    Level: advanced
374ff2fd236SBarry Smith 
375f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es   Usage:
3767b2a1423SBarry Smith $    extern int mult(Mat,Vec,Vec);
377f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$    MatCreateShell(comm,m,n,M,N,ctx,&mat);
378c134de8dSSatish Balay $    MatShellSetOperation(mat,MATOP_MULT,(void(*)(void))mult);
379f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$    [ Use matrix for operations that have been set ]
380f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$    MatDestroy(mat);
381f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es 
382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    Notes:
383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    The shell matrix type is intended to provide a simple class to use
384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    with KSP (such as, for use with matrix-free methods). You should not
385ff756334SLois Curfman McInnes    use the shell type if you plan to define a complete matrix class.
386e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
387f38a8d56SBarry Smith    Fortran Notes: The context can only be an integer or a PetscObject
388f38a8d56SBarry Smith       unfortunately it cannot be a Fortran array or derived type.
389f38a8d56SBarry Smith 
390f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es    PETSc requires that matrices and vectors being used for certain
391f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es    operations are partitioned accordingly.  For example, when
392645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    creating a shell matrix, A, that supports parallel matrix-vector
393645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    products using MatMult(A,x,y) the user should set the number
394645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    of local matrix rows to be the number of local elements of the
395645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    corresponding result vector, y. Note that this is information is
396645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    required for use of the matrix interface routines, even though
397645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    the shell matrix may not actually be physically partitioned.
398645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es    For example,
399f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es 
400f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$
401f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$     Vec x, y
4027b2a1423SBarry Smith $     extern int mult(Mat,Vec,Vec);
403645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es $     Mat A
404f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$
405c94f878dSBarry Smith $     VecCreateMPI(comm,PETSC_DECIDE,M,&y);
406c94f878dSBarry Smith $     VecCreateMPI(comm,PETSC_DECIDE,N,&x);
407f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$     VecGetLocalSize(y,&m);
408c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ith $     VecGetLocalSize(x,&n);
409c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ith $     MatCreateShell(comm,m,n,M,N,ctx,&A);
410c134de8dSSatish Balay $     MatShellSetOperation(mat,MATOP_MULT,(void(*)(void))mult);
411645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es $     MatMult(A,x,y);
412645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es $     MatDestroy(A);
413f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$     VecDestroy(y); VecDestroy(x);
414645985a0SLois Curfman McInnes $
415e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
4160b627109SLois Curfman McInnes .keywords: matrix, shell, create
4170b627109SLois Curfman McInnes 
418ab50ec6bSBarry Smith .seealso: MatShellSetOperation(), MatHasOperation(), MatShellGetContext(), MatShellSetContext()
419e51e0e81SBarry Smith @*/

468c16cb8f2SBarry Smith /*@C
4693a3eedf2SBarry Smith     MatShellSetOperation - Allows user to set a matrix operation for
4703a3eedf2SBarry Smith                            a shell matrix.
471e51e0e81SBarry Smith 
472fee21e36SBarry Smith    Collective on Mat
473fee21e36SBarry Smith 
474c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ith     Input Parameters:
475c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ith +   mat - the shell matrix
476c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ith .   op - the name of the operation
477c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ith -   f - the function that provides the operation.
478c7fcc2eaSBarry Smith 
47915091d37SBarry Smith    Level: advanced
48015091d37SBarry Smith 
481fae171e0SBarry Smith     Usage:
482e93bc3c1Svictor $      extern PetscErrorCode usermult(Mat,Vec,Vec);
483f39d1f56SLois Curfman McInnes $      ierr = MatCreateShell(comm,m,n,M,N,ctx,&A);
484c134de8dSSatish Balay $      ierr = MatShellSetOperation(A,MATOP_MULT,(void(*)(void))usermult);
4850b627109SLois Curfman McInnes 
486a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     Notes:
487e090d566SSatish Balay     See the file include/petscmat.h for a complete list of matrix
4881c1c02c0SLois Curfman McInnes     operations, which all have the form MATOP_<OPERATION>, where
489a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     <OPERATION> is the name (in all capital letters) of the
4901c1c02c0SLois Curfman McInnes     user interface routine (e.g., MatMult() -> MATOP_MULT).
491a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es 
492a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     All user-provided functions should have the same calling
493deebb3c3SLois Curfman McInnes     sequence as the usual matrix interface routines, since they
494deebb3c3SLois Curfman McInnes     are intended to be accessed via the usual matrix interface
495deebb3c3SLois Curfman McInnes     routines, e.g.,
496a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es $       MatMult(Mat,Vec,Vec) -> usermult(Mat,Vec,Vec)
497a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es 
498a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     Within each user-defined routine, the user should call
499a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     MatShellGetContext() to obtain the user-defined context that was
500a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es     set by MatCreateShell().
501a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es 
502a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es .keywords: matrix, shell, set, operation
503a62d957aSLois Curfman McInnes 
504ab50ec6bSBarry Smith .seealso: MatCreateShell(), MatShellGetContext(), MatShellGetOperation(), MatShellSetContext()
505e51e0e81SBarry Smith @*/
